Notable events — 1547 AD
- Jan 28 Henry VIII dies; Edward VI succeeds him.
- Mar 31 Francis I of France dies; Henry II succeeds him.
- Apr 24 Charles V crushes the Schmalkaldic League at Mühlberg.
